Syncing Fixtures to Your Calendar

Keeping track of Premier League fixtures can be challenging, but syncing them to your calendar ensures you never miss a match. Sky Sports offers fixture calendars in iCalendar/ICS format compatible with most devices and calendar apps. By subscribing to these calendars, fans can receive automatic updates and stay informed about the latest fixture details on various devices.

For Google Calendar users, syncing is straightforward. Paste the calendar URL under ‘Add by URL’ after logging into your Google account.

iOS users can add subscribed calendars by navigating to ‘Mail, Contacts, Calendars’ in settings and selecting ‘Add Subscribed Calendar’ with the provided URL. Android users can manage syncing through the Google Calendar app, activating subscribed fixtures under ‘Calendars to be displayed’.

This seamless integration keeps you up-to-date with your favorite team’s schedule.

International Breaks and Fixture Adjustments

international breaks and fixture adjustments.

International breaks are a significant aspect of the Premier League season, often leading to adjustments in the fixture schedule. These breaks can impact match timings and player availability, requiring teams to carefully manage their squads. The 2024/25 season will feature four international breaks, each coinciding with national team matches.

These breaks are scheduled from September 2nd to September 10th, October 7th to October 15th, November 11th to November 19th, and March 17th to March 25th. Teams must navigate these periods effectively to maintain their form and manage player fatigue. While essential for national teams, international breaks can pose challenges for Premier League clubs.

Championship Sunday

Championship Sunday, set for May 25, 2025, is one of the most anticipated dates in the Premier League calendar. On this final day of the season, all matches will begin at the same time, creating an atmosphere of high drama and excitement. This synchronization ensures that no team has an advantage, and the outcomes are decided on the pitch in real-time.

This day is crucial as it often determines the league champions, European qualifiers, and the teams facing relegation. The simultaneous kickoffs add to the suspense, making Championship Sunday a must-watch event for football fans around the world.
